CERN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

631 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cerner Corp (CERN)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$20.7B — up 14% from $18.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 69 funds opened new CERN posit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 39 holders — while 214 added to existing stakes and 249 trimmed.

The largest buyer was William Blair & Company, adding an estimated $197M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$124M.
